Rapid Action Battalion (RAB)-7 has arrested Nazim Uddin, 52, a fugitive accused in the murder case of Jamaat-e-Islami activist Jamal Uddin in Fatikchhari, Chattogram. The arrest took place around 3:45 p.m. on Monday in front of Enayetbazar Mohila College under Kotwali Police Station in Chattogram city. RAB confirmed the arrest on Tuesday, stating that Nazim had been frequently changing locations and blending into crowds to evade capture.

According to the report, Jamal Uddin, a local businessman and Jamaat activist, was shot dead on Saturday evening at Shahnogor Dighir Par area of Lelang Union in Fatikchhari. Three armed men on a motorcycle fired at him from close range, killing him on the spot. Thirteen bullet wounds were found from his head to neck, while another man, Nasir Uddin, was injured and remains under treatment at Chattogram Medical College Hospital.

RAB handed Nazim over to Fatikchhari police after initial questioning. Investigators said the arrest could advance the case, as they are examining whether old rivalries, business disputes, or local political conflicts were behind the killing.
